Before you enrol
Important course requirements
Course format
This course includes online theory and a required face-to-face classroom practical session. It cannot be completed fully online. To be marked competent, students must complete the required online theory, attend the classroom practical session, participate in practical CPR scenarios, and successfully complete CPR assessment requirements.
CPR and practical ability
CPR assessment requires students to perform at least 2 minutes of uninterrupted CPR on an adult manikin placed on the floor. If you have an injury, disability, pregnancy, mobility restriction, or any other concern that may affect your ability to complete practical tasks, please contact Eclipse Education before booking so we can discuss support options or reasonable adjustments. Reasonable adjustments can be made where appropriate, but they cannot change the required skills or assessment conditions of the unit.
Enrolment requirements
Photo ID is required before assessment evidence can be accepted. A USI is required before your Statement of Attainment can be issued. An LLN and digital literacy check may be completed at enrolment to confirm the course is suitable and identify any support needs.
